An RFID tag and reader work together to identify, capture, and transmit asset information automatically, enabling real-time tracking, faster inventory management, improved operational efficiency, and reliable data collection without manual barcode scanning.
After commissioning RFID systems in manufacturing plants, logistics hubs, and industrial warehouses over the past several years, I’ve noticed one misconception repeated again and again. Companies often focus on purchasing a powerful RFID reader while overlooking tag selection. In practice, successful RFID deployments depend on the interaction between both components. A high-performance reader cannot compensate for an unsuitable tag attached to metal, liquid containers, or fast-moving assets. The best results always come from treating the RFID tag and reader as one integrated system rather than two independent products.
An RFID tag stores a unique electronic identity.
An RFID reader transmits radio frequency signals, powers passive RFID tags, receives their responses, and forwards identification data to business software.
Neither component delivers value independently.
Only when the reader, antenna, RFID tag, and software platform operate together does a complete RFID identification system emerge.
Today, most industrial deployments use passive UHF RFID based on EPC Gen2 / ISO/IEC 18000-63, the global standard promoted by GS1 and supported by the RAIN Alliance.
According to the RAIN Alliance, global shipments exceeded 50 billion RAIN RFID tags in 2023, reflecting rapid adoption across logistics, manufacturing, healthcare, aviation, and retail.
A Cykeo fixed RFID reader continuously transmits radio frequency energy through connected antennas.
Passive RFID tags harvest energy from the RF field and immediately transmit their unique EPC identifier.
The RFID middleware filters duplicate reads before forwarding data to ERP, WMS, MES, or asset management software.
Within milliseconds, inventory records update automatically.

Different environments require different tag designs.
| Application | Recommended RFID Tag |
|---|---|
| Metal equipment | On-metal RFID tag |
| Plastic containers | Standard UHF label |
| Returnable transport items | Rugged hard tag |
| High-temperature production | High-temperature RFID tag |
| Outdoor assets | IP-rated industrial tag |
During one warehouse deployment, replacing standard adhesive labels with dedicated on-metal tags increased read consistency dramatically without changing the reader configuration. The lesson was clear: system performance often depends more on tag selection than reader power.

Across manufacturing, warehousing, and logistics projects, our engineering team has learned that reliable RFID performance rarely depends on the reader specification alone.
Reader placement, antenna polarization, tag orientation, environmental reflections, conveyor speed, and software filtering all influence final read performance.
That is why Cykeo engineers evaluate complete application scenarios before recommending hardware. Selecting the correct RFID tag together with the appropriate industrial reader consistently delivers higher long-term performance than simply choosing the highest-powered device.
